S09385 Summary:

BILL NOS09385
 
SAME ASSAME AS A10240-A
 
SPONSORZELLNER
 
COSPNSR
 
MLTSPNSR
 
Amd §§502 & 502-a, RWB L; amd Part JJ §2, Chap 56 of 2023
 
Establishes additional qualifications for the board members of regional off-track betting corporations.

S09385 Text:



 
                STATE OF NEW YORK
        ________________________________________________________________________
 
                                          9385
 
                    IN SENATE
 
                                      March 6, 2026
                                       ___________
 
        Introduced  by  Sen. ZELLNER -- read twice and ordered printed, and when
          printed to be committed to the Committee on Racing, Gaming and  Wager-
          ing
 
        AN  ACT  to  amend the racing, pari-mutuel wagering and breeding law, in
          relation  to  additional  qualifications  for  the  board  members  of
          regional  off-track  betting  corporations;  and to amend section 2 of
          part JJ of chapter 56 of the laws of 2023 amending the  racing,  pari-
          mutuel  wagering and breeding law, relating  to the  membership of the
          board of directors of the western regional  off-track  betting  corpo-
          ration, in relation to the effectiveness thereof
 
          The  People of the State of New York, represented in Senate and Assem-
        bly, do enact as follows:
 
     1    Section 1. Subdivision 1 of section 502  of  the  racing,  pari-mutuel
     2  wagering  and  breeding  law,  as  amended by chapter 710 of the laws of
     3  1990, is amended to read as follows:
     4    1. a. A regional off-track betting corporation is  hereby  established
     5  for  each region, except the New York city region for which the New York
     6  city off-track betting corporation established pursuant to  and  subject
     7  to article six of this chapter shall constitute the regional corporation
     8  and  such  article six shall govern such New York city off-track betting
     9  corporation. Each regional corporation shall be  a  body  corporate  and
    10  politic  constituting  a  public  benefit  corporation. Each corporation
    11  shall be administered by a board of directors consisting of two  members
    12  from  each  participating  county  containing a city of over one hundred
    13  fifty thousand in population, according to the last federal census,  and
    14  one  member  from  each  other participating county. Notwithstanding any
    15  other provision of law to the contrary, the members shall  be  appointed
    16  by the county governing body, and may, at the discretion of such govern-
    17  ing  body  of  counties which have a population of less than two hundred
    18  thousand, include sitting members of such governing body. A member of  a
    19  governing  body  who  is appointed a director after July first, nineteen
    20  hundred ninety shall not be compensated  by  the  regional  corporation;
    21  provided,  however,  that  the mayor of a city of over one hundred fifty
    22  thousand that has elected to participate in the management of  a  corpo-

     1  ration  pursuant  to  subdivision  two  of  this section shall, with the
     2  approval of the city's legislative body, appoint one of the  members  to
     3  which  the  county  containing such city is entitled. In the case of the
     4  corporation  established  for  the Suffolk region and Nassau region, the
     5  board of directors of each corporation shall consist  of  three  members
     6  appointed  by  the  governing  body of each county, not more than two of
     7  whom shall be members of the same political party. Each  director  shall
     8  serve  at  the  pleasure of the governing body or mayor appointing [him]
     9  such director, as the case may be. A [chairman] chair shall  be  elected
    10  by the members to serve a term of one year.
    11    b.  No  person  who has served as a member, officer or employee of the
    12  corporation shall within a period  of  ten  years  after  such  person's
    13  termination  of such service or employment, regardless of the reason for
    14  termination, (i) be appointed or qualified as a  member  of  the  corpo-
    15  ration;  or (ii) appear, practice before, or communicate with the corpo-
    16  ration, directly or indirectly, to promote  or  oppose  the  passage  of
    17  resolutions by the board of directors.
    18    c. No person who is appointed to be a member of the board of directors
    19  may  attend  or  participate  in any board meetings, including executive
    20  sessions, until  that  person's  application  for  a  license  has  been
    21  approved by the commission.
    22    §  2. Subdivisions 6 and 7 of section 502-a of the racing, pari-mutuel
    23  wagering and breeding law are renumbered subdivisions 7 and 8 and a  new
    24  subdivision 6 is added to read as follows:
    25    6. a. No person who has served as a member, officer or employee of the
    26  corporation  shall  within  a  period  of  ten years after such person's
    27  termination of such service or employment, regardless of the reason  for
    28  termination,  (i)  be  appointed  or qualified as a member of the corpo-
    29  ration; or (ii) appear, practice before, or communicate with the  corpo-
    30  ration,  directly  or  indirectly,  to  promote or oppose the passage of
    31  resolutions by the board of directors.
    32    b. No person who is appointed to be a member of the board of directors
    33  may attend or participate in any  board  meetings,  including  executive
    34  sessions,  until  that  person's  application  for  a  license  has been
    35  approved by the commission.
    36    § 3. Section 2 of part JJ of chapter 56 of the laws of 2023,  amending
    37  the  racing,  pari-mutuel  wagering  and  breeding  law, relating to the
    38  membership of the board of directors of the western  regional  off-track
    39  betting corporation, is amended to read as follows:
    40    §  2.  This act shall take effect immediately; provided, however, that
    41  effective immediately, cities and counties may take any action necessary
    42  to begin the selection and appointment  process  for  new  board  member
    43  terms pursuant to this act; and provided further, that upon selection of
    44  new  board  members, cities and counties shall notify the corporation of
    45  their respective appointments via certified mail; and provided  further,
    46  that  this act shall expire and be deemed repealed [four] fourteen years
    47  after such effective date.
    48    § 4. This act shall take effect immediately; provided,  however,  that
    49  the  amendments to section 502-a of the racing, pari-mutuel wagering and
    50  breeding law made by section two of this act shall not affect the repeal
    51  of such section and shall be deemed repealed therewith.
